As early voting begins April 20, here is everything voters in Conroe and Montgomery need to know ahead of the May 2 election.
What residents should know
For the upcoming election, voters should note the following dates:
- April 20: First day of early voting and last day to apply for ballot by mail (received, not postmarked)
- April 28: Last day of early voting
- May 2: Election day and the last day to receive ballot by mail (or May 4 if carrier envelope is postmarked by 7 p.m. at location of election)
In Montgomery County, voters can cast their ballots at any polling location during early voting. However, on election day, voters in Montgomery County must vote at their designated voting precincts. Visit
https://elections.mctx.org for polling locations.
